What Are Carbide Buttons?

Carbide buttons are sintered components derived primarily from tungsten carbide and a metallic binder, such as cobalt. Their unique structure imparts extreme hardness—often exceeding that of steel—making them ideal as cutting, drilling, and shaping tips in heavy-duty tools and equipment. The application-specific design, from flat-topped cylinders to conical points, means carbide buttons can be found in everything from rotary drill bits to tunneling machines, construction tools, and wear-resistant machinery parts. Their ability to endure high impact, abrasive environments, and rapid thermal cycling ensures longevity where other materials quickly fail.

Technology and Manufacturing Process of Carbide Buttons

Raw Material Selection

The process begins by selecting high-purity tungsten carbide powder, which is carefully blended with cobalt or another metallic binder. The science behind the blend ratio is critical—these elements must achieve a fine balance between hardness and toughness, with the binder adding required flexibility and shock absorption.

Powder Mixing and Milling

The powders are intensely mixed and milled to ensure homogeneity, with strict controls over particle size distribution. Consistency at this stage guarantees uniform properties in every manufactured button.

Compacting and Press Forming

Next, the blended powder is pressed into molds under high pressure, forming what is called a “green compact.” This pre-sintered shape defines the basic form of the carbide button, dictating preliminary size and geometry.

Sintering

Green compacts undergo sintering at extreme temperatures in controlled atmospheres, often in vacuum or with protective gases. During sintering, powder particles bond at a molecular level, densifying the material and imparting the signature hardness and mechanical stability seen in finished carbide buttons.

Precision Grinding and Final Machining

Once sintered, carbide buttons are ground and machined for exact tolerances using advanced CNC and centerless grinding systems. This ensures dimensional accuracy and smooth finishes, which directly affect tool performance and lifespan.

Surface Finishing and Quality Control

Some carbide buttons receive specialized coatings or surface treatments to further improve wear resistance and reduce friction. Every button is meticulously inspected for dimensional accuracy, density, and absence of visual defects, ensuring it meets both domestic and international standards.

Methods for Inserting Carbide Buttons into Tools

Successful deployment of carbide buttons into tools or bits is as important as the production process itself. The three major methods are copper brazing, cold pressing, and hot pressing.

- Copper Brazing: The oldest method, involves welding the buttons in place using copper or silver brazing alloys. Though cost-effective, this method may reduce the hardness of the carbide due to exposure to high temperatures and is typically reserved for single-use applications.

- Cold Pressing: This method uses hydraulic force at room temperature to press fit the button into pre-drilled holes. While efficient, it can result in lower bond stability and is best suited to less abrasive environments or for bits facing soft rock formations.

- Hot Pressing: Currently considered the best technique, hot pressing involves heating the tool body to expand the holes, inserting the carbide button, and then cooling to “lock” the button in place via thermal contraction. This method maximizes bond strength, preserves the carbide's original properties, and ensures the longest tool life in heavy-duty and abrasive applications.

Each method has technical advantages and is selected based on the specific demands of the application and required button longevity.
